Parents 'very proud' being part of study for premature babies

Daisy Salter weighed just over a pound of butter when she was born, when parents Katie and Neil Salter choose to get her cord cut after 60 seconds as part of a ground-breaking study to improve survival rate of premature babies. Source - University Of Auckland
